Job Summary

We are seeking a Sound Technician to join our technical team. The role focuses on sound but also involves lighting, stage management, and flying. Candidates should have knowledge of technical theatre, experience with digital consoles and networking, and ability to rig and cable small-medium set ups.

Job Description

To assist in the facilitation of technical operations, and performances and events at Harlow Playhouse.
To assist and design as required on all events and performances at the Playhouse.
To maintain relevant performance, rehearsal and public areas in good working order in line with pre-agreed procedures.

Job Requirements

The successful candidate will have the following qualifications, experience and skills:
* GCSE English and Maths Grade A-C or minimum Level 4 or equivalent.
* Experience of theatre sound, and one of the following: Lighting; stage management; or stage flying.
* Flexible with working hours
* Physical work – some heavy lifting and working at heights.
* Basic DBS check
* Calm under pressure
* Willing and able to learn and develop new skills
